VAN SAUN COUNTY PARK WILL BE NEW JERSEY’S PREMIER DESTINATION FOR WINTER FAMILY FUN


Bergen County’s Winter Wonderland & New Holiday Lantern Spectacular Open on November 26
(PARAMUS, NJ) – Bergen County Executive Jim Tedesco and the Bergen County Board of Commissioners are excited to announce that Van Saun County Park in Paramus will soon become New Jersey’s premier destination for winter family fun.

Starting on Friday, November 26 at 4 p.m., Bergen County’s Winter Wonderland is set to make its triumphant return to Van Saun County Park with open air ice skating, a non-ice children’s beginners rink, a heated hospitality tent, games, activities, food trucks, an indoor/outdoor beer and wine garden, carousel rides, and rides on the Bergen County Express Train. From the giant tinsel candy canes framing the entrance of the event grounds, to the festive decorations throughout, families will have the chance to be transported to a winter paradise this holiday season right here in Bergen County.

Simultaneously, right across the street, Van Saun County Park will also host the first ever Let It GLOW! A Holiday Lantern Spectacular at the Bergen County Zoo. The spectacular, sponsored by the Friends of the Bergen County Zoo in partnership with Tianyu Arts & Culture, Inc., will feature traditional Chinese lanterns with a modern twist, including dozens of hand-painted, larger-than-life structures that celebrate culture, animals, and the warmth of the holidays. With over 30 different scenes, each hand-made, artistic wonder is more breathtaking than the last. Festivities are also set to begin on Friday, November 26 at 4 p.m.

Bergen County’s Winter Wonderland Hours of Operation and Upcoming Events

November 26 through January 2

The hours of operation are Fridays, 4 p.m. – 9 p.m.; Saturdays, 11 a.m. – 9 p.m.; and Sundays, 11 a.m. – 7 p.m. Monday-Thursdays, the ice rink will be open for skating from 4 p.m. – 8 p.m. Winter Wonderland will have adjusted hours on Christmas Eve (12/24) and New Year’s Eve (12/31) and operate 11 a.m. – 6 p.m. From December 2 – January 2, Winter Wonderland will operate 11 a.m. -9 p.m. Winter Wonderland will be closed on Christmas (12/25).

Bergen County’s Winter Wonderland in partnership with the New Jersey Devils is also proud to host Learn to Play Hockey this season! Learn to Play is designed to teach your child the fundamentals of ice hockey. On-ice sessions are run by USA Hockey certified coaches as well as New Jersey Devils Alumni and are structured to be both instructional and FUN!
